Homeowners seek backup generator solutions for power outages

Homeowners are increasingly seeking advice on backup power solutions following frequent electricity outages. Online discussions on platforms like Reddit have highlighted various strategies for maintaining essential appliances during blackouts.

For those needing to power limited items, such as a refrigerator and a window air conditioning unit, experts suggest small suitcase generators, often requiring approximately 2000 watts. Fuel options discussed include gasoline, propane, or dual-fuel systems that offer the convenience of switching between types.

For larger-scale residential needs, discussions have centered on comparing major standby generator brands like Generac and Kohler. When choosing between high-capacity whole-house units, users recommend prioritizing local service availability and technician support. Another option for those facing infrequent but prolonged outages is the use of portable tri-fuel units, which can run on natural gas, liquid propane, or gasoline and can be stored in a garage or shed.
